An uniquely designed structure of concrete, steel and native stone from the area, the Cherokee National Museum is constructed on the National Register of Historic Sites location of the old Cherokee Female Seminary which operated on the site from 1851 to 1887 until it burned. The prison, as built in 1874 for $6000, was a two-story building with a basement. This historic building played host to the original printing press of the Cherokee Advocate, the Cherokee Nation's official publication and the first newspaper in Oklahoma. Built in 1844, this is the oldest government building in Oklahoma and housed the Cherokee National Supreme Court. Cherokee National Prison Museum. The Cherokee National Supreme Court Museum showcases the history of the Cherokee judicial system, written language and the evolution of Cherokee journalism. 780 likes. It is … The Cherokee Heritage Center was established by the Cherokee Historical Society in 1966 on the original Park Hill site of the Cherokee National Female Seminary. The Cherokee National History Museum is an art and cultural history museum in Tahlequah, Oklahoma, United States.Established in 2019, it is housed in the historic Cherokee Nation Supreme Court building, formerly known as the Cherokee National Capitol building.
